Senior Software Engineer

7 days ago


Australia carsales Limited Full time
About the Role

We are seeking a highly skilled Senior Software Engineer to join our ACIL Tribe at Carsales Limited. As a key member of our team, you will be responsible for delivering scalable data architectures and data product development & design best practices.

Key Responsibilities
  • Contribute to the development of data pipelines and solutions, collaborating with cross-functional teams to drive business outcomes.
  • Lead technical recommendations and decision-making, mentoring early-career engineers to grow the team's capabilities.
  • Own the delivery of allocated initiatives within specified scope, time, and budget.
  • Engage in facilitating team-based problem-solving sessions and contribute to the development of best practices.
  • Initiate and nurture effective working relationships, acting as a trusted advisor on product analytics and commercial data solutions.
Requirements
  • An all-of-business mindset, leading with high levels of personal integrity and accountability.
  • Skilled at distilling business and analytics requirements into well-defined engineering problems.
  • Proficient in containerization platforms (e.g. Docker) and CI/CD pipelines.
  • Track record architecting, building, and integrating with RESTful APIs and microservices architectures.
  • Experience with distributed technologies and data-intensive processing frameworks (e.g. Airflow, HDFS, Spark, EMR).
  • Proficient in at least two programming languages (e.g. Python, Spark, Scala). Experience with.Net frameworks highly favorable.
About Us

Carsales Limited is an equal opportunity employer who prides themselves on fostering a diverse and inclusive workplace. We encourage everyone of all ages, genders, and backgrounds to apply. If you're a candidate with a disability or you'll need some adjustments to be at your best, let us know how we can provide you with additional support.

We know how important keeping that balance between work/life is and have a range of flexible working options on offer, including part-time. We are open to this conversation during our recruitment process if you want to know more, just ask.



  • Australia Sage Lake Senior Living Full time

    About the RoleWe are seeking a highly skilled Senior Software Engineer to join our team at Sage Lake Senior Living. As a key member of our engineering team, you will be responsible for designing, developing, and implementing software solutions that meet the needs of our customers in the logistics and supply chain industry.Key ResponsibilitiesDesign and...


  • Australia SENIOR SPIRIT OF ROSELLE PARK Full time

    About the Role:We're seeking a Senior Full Stack Software Engineer to join our team at SENIOR SPIRIT OF ROSELLE PARK and play a key role in developing and implementing technology solutions that power our Meetings and Workplace product offerings. We are looking for someone with strong experience in React apps powered by microservices.Key Responsibilities:Lead...

  • Software Engineer

    6 days ago


    Australia Josh Software Full time

    About Josh SoftwareWe are a leading software development company that specializes in delivering innovative solutions to our clients. Our team is comprised of experienced professionals who are passionate about technology and committed to excellence.Job SummaryWe are seeking a highly skilled Software Engineer to join our team. The successful candidate will be...


  • Australia Tantalus Media Pty Full time

    Job Title: Senior Software EngineerWe are seeking an experienced Senior Software Engineer to join our team at Tantalus Media Pty. As a Senior Software Engineer, you will be responsible for designing, developing, and testing high-quality software applications.Key Responsibilities:Collaborate with cross-functional teams to identify and prioritize project...


  • Australia JAM Software GmbH Full time

    About JAM Software GmbHJAM Software GmbH is a leading provider of innovative software solutions for the Built Environment, Manufacturing, and Zero Emissions industries. With 20 years of experience in business consulting and technology expertise, we deliver cutting-edge solutions that empower our clients to succeed.The RoleWe are seeking a highly skilled...


  • Australia Onset Group Full time

    Job OpportunitySenior Java Software EngineerAbout the RoleWe are seeking a highly skilled Senior Java Software Engineer to join our team at Onset Group. As a key member of our development team, you will be responsible for designing and developing cutting-edge software systems for our maritime clients and future submarine programs.Key ResponsibilitiesDesign...

  • Software Engineer

    1 week ago


    Australia Impero Software Limited Full time

    About Impero Software Limited: We are a leading technology company that specializes in creating innovative solutions to keep people, devices, and connections safe and effective. Our mission is to develop cutting-edge technology that enables secure and seamless connections in various environments, including education and the workforce. We have a strong...


  • Australia Josh Software Full time

    At Josh Software, we're dedicated to harnessing the power of technology to connect our customers with the people they serve. With over 15 years of experience, we've established a strong presence in key strategic geographies worldwide, including the USA, Australia, Europe, SE Asia, and India.Key Responsibilities:Design and build scalable and highly-available...


  • Australia Atlassian Full time

    About Atlassian:We're a software company that empowers teams to achieve their goals. Our products help teams collaborate, plan, and track their work. We're committed to diversity and inclusion, and we believe that everyone deserves an equal opportunity to succeed.About the Team:The Atlassian Cloud Storage Engineering team is responsible for developing and...


  • Australia Talenza Pty Limited. Full time

    Job SummaryTalenza Pty Limited is seeking a highly experienced Senior Software Engineer to lead a team of talented software engineers and solution designers in the design and build of a complex financial services platform for a Big Four Bank.Key ResponsibilitiesBe the subject matter expert on Software Engineering, providing high-level and low-level technical...


  • Australia Talenza Pty Limited. Full time

    Job SummaryTalenza Pty Limited is seeking a highly experienced Senior Software Engineer to lead a team of talented software engineers and solution designers in the design and build of a complex financial services platform for a Big Four Bank.Key ResponsibilitiesBe the subject matter expert on Software Engineering, providing high-level and low-level technical...


  • Australia Software Aspekte Full time

    We are seeking a highly skilled Software Development Engineer in Test to join our team at Software Aspekte. As a key member of our quality assurance team, you will play a crucial role in ensuring the reliability and stability of our software solutions.Key Responsibilities:Design, develop, and execute automated test scripts to validate software functionality...

  • Software Engineer

    23 hours ago


    Australia Enlab Software Full time

    About This PositionWe are seeking a highly skilled Software Engineer to join our team at Enlab Software. As a key member of our development team, you will play a crucial role in designing, implementing, and maintaining cutting-edge web applications using React and related technologies.Key ResponsibilitiesLiaise with cross-functional teams and clients to...


  • Australia SENIOR SPIRIT OF ROSELLE PARK Full time

    About the RoleWe are seeking a highly skilled Senior Systems Engineer to join our team at SENIOR SPIRIT OF ROSELLE PARK. As a Senior Systems Engineer, you will be responsible for the ongoing engineering, support, and project delivery of our portfolio of products.Key ResponsibilitiesConceptualize, develop, test, and implement new features in data acquisition,...


  • Australia Atlassian Full time

    About the RoleWe're seeking an experienced Senior Backend Software Engineer to join our team at Atlassian. As a key member of our engineering team, you'll be responsible for designing, developing, and maintaining our backend systems.Key ResponsibilitiesLead the design and development of complex backend systems, ensuring scalability, reliability, and...


  • Australia Woolworths Limited Full time

    Job SummaryWe are seeking an experienced Android Engineer to join our team at Woolworths Limited. As a Senior Android Software Engineer, you will be responsible for building robust and sustainable solutions that offer real value to our customers.Key ResponsibilitiesDesign and develop high-quality Android applications using best practices and industry...


  • Australia Iterate Recruitment Pty Full time

    About the Role:We are seeking a highly skilled Senior Software Engineer to join our Platform Engineering team at Iterate Recruitment Pty. As a key member of our team, you will be responsible for designing, developing, and maintaining scalable and efficient cloud-based infrastructure using Azure resources.Key Responsibilities:Design and implement cloud-based...


  • Australia CloudBolt Software, Inc. Full time

    About the RoleWe are seeking a highly skilled Senior Cloud Reliability Engineer to join our team at CloudBolt Software, Inc. As a key member of our global customer support team, you will be responsible for ensuring the seamless experience of our clients with our software and SaaS product.Key ResponsibilitiesClient Support: Serve as the primary point of...


  • Australia CloudBolt Software, Inc. Full time

    About the RoleWe are seeking a highly skilled and experienced Senior Technical Support Engineer to join our team at CloudBolt Software, Inc. As a key member of our support team, you will be responsible for providing exceptional technical support to our clients, ensuring they have a seamless experience with our software and SaaS product.Key...

  • Software Developer

    7 days ago


    Australia Enlab Software Full time

    **About Enlab Software**We are a leading software development company that delivers top-notch solutions to clients worldwide. Our team is passionate about creating innovative and user-friendly products that meet the needs of our clients.**Job Summary**We are seeking a highly skilled Software Engineer (Angular) to join our team at Enlab. As a Software...